FIBA 3x3 World Tour Final 2016 Pool D Preview

BEIJING (FIBA 3x3 World Tour Final) - With Zemun Master (SRB), Piran (SLO) and Saskatoon (CAN), Pool D is definitely the most dangerous division at the FIBA 3x3 World Tour Bloomage Beijing Final.

STORY

Pool D like Pool of Death, with a rookie team that has competed in 5 Masters this year and 2 World Tour powerhouses.
D like Dynamite like what former number 1 player in the world Simon Finzgar has in his legs this year.
D like the Dragon Bogdan Dragovic, the Zemun star who ranks 3rd overall in the scoring list with his fireballs from behind the arc and one of the meanest shammgods on the circuit.
D like "Don’t reach, young blood" as Saskatoon captain Michael Linklater has put more people on skates than Tony Hawk.
D like Dynasty as Saskatoon and Piran have played in a combined 7 World Tour Finals.
D like "Do it again" as Piran and Zemun have met twice in the last 2 Masters. Two absolute World Tour classics with plot twists more insane than the Sixth Sense.
